5 Things You Must Know Earlier than Starting To Train MMA
There are some things it's best to know earlier than starting to train MMA, in order to make an informed choice and determine if this is really something you can or ought to do.
1. Can your body take it?
Before starting any form of physical activity, you must consult your physician; particularly when it is an intense form of activity, comparable to mixed martial arts training. Even when you feel completely healthy and don't easily tire, you still need to do it. There are lots of serious health problems than cannot be felt until it is too late, and that rigorous training can aggravate.
2. MMA is all about cross-training
So as to be a successful MMA fighter, it's a must to cross-train. You'll be able to't just be one-dimensional nowadays, as MMA fighting methods have evolved over the years. If within the ninety's, during the first televised blended martial arts events, a pure submission grappler corresponding to Royce Gracie was able to dominate other fighters, at the moment you can't make it when you only know Brazilian jiu-jitsu. Everybody has access to a various training and in case your game is only primarily based on one dimension, your probabilities of profitable a combat are slim to none. A mix between wrestling (Greco-roman or even freestyle wrestling), Brazilian jiu-jitsu (or one other submission grappling art comparable to catch wrestling or sambo) and muay thai skills is considered to be an excellent blend in MMA and, when you've got a background in one in all these, you already have a good base to build on.
However, if you happen to already are an excellent wrestler, a great submission grappler and a good striker, you won't essentially turn out to be a good MMA fighter. You still want a specialised MMA trainer to show you the right way to combine all of these skills, alongside with everything else that's particular to the sport.
3. Keep humble
If in case you have a big ego, think again before becoming a member of an MMA gym. You'll be able to still do it, however if you cannot be humble within the gym, you will either discover ways to do it the hard way, or be forced to leave. Do not forget that you join a gym to learn something, to not prove the other guys there that you are higher than them. That's not the attitude of a fighter, and never many people tolerate that.
The willingness to learn is probably one the most important attributes of a fighter. You have to study out of your own mistakes, and to keep in mind that generally you be taught a lot more from a loss that from a win. Do not get mad or discouraged in case you always lose during sparring, but attempt to study from these experiences till you get higher and it is your flip to win.
4. Eat healthy and sleep
Without proper nutrition, training is almost useless. In the event you resolve to begin MMA training, you should know there are some life-style adjustments that should be made first. Consuming proper and drinking a number of water is among the most important. This will not only mean you can adjust better to training, it will also make you healthier and give you the looks of an athlete.
And also you will have to say goodbye to these wild party nights each week. You will have to sleep at the very least eight hours each night time, as proper recovery is the key to not getting injured.
5. Take it easy
Don't train too much. You might have a lot to study, and that will take plenty of time. There's the wrestling, the striking, the clinching, the submitting, the conditioning and lots of other features that should be developed. Even in case you think you can do it, do not attempt to take any shortcuts, and train like a mad man from the primary week. You will only get injured, and even sick. 3 times a week is a charm, until you get used to it and may improve training time.
